I'm a big fan of David B. with the exception of the few books where he retells his dreams which I find, unsurpisingly, aimless. I purchased the two existing tomes of Babel over 15 years ago and had very little memory of having read them. I read them in full last week, and all I can say is that I really wish the series had gone on. It's gorgeous, both in terms of narrative structure and colour. The closest it feels is to l'Ascension du Haut Mal (Epileptic) which is largely (and rightly) considered to be his masterpiece. As it stands, Babel will stand as an unfinished minor masterpiece.
